How it works
You speak at 160 words per minute. You type at 40. No setup. No learning curve. Just press, speak, done.
Press and hold fn in any app. A waveform appears in your menu bar.
Talk at your normal pace. A live waveform confirms it's listening.
Release the key. Your words appear as text — instantly.

Accessibility
Whether it's carpal tunnel, RSI, or just thinking faster than you type — your voice shouldn't be slowed down by a keyboard.
Uses macOS Accessibility APIs to place transcribed text exactly at your cursor — the same system-level technology that powers screen readers and switch control.
One key press replaces hundreds of keystrokes. Hold to record, release to transcribe — giving your hands a break when typing becomes painful or impossible.
Whether it's ADHD, dysgraphia, or stream-of-consciousness thinking — capture your thoughts at the speed you think them, not the speed you type.
